【摘要】 目的应用基于体素的形态测量学(VBM)方法,分析慢性原发性三叉神经痛(CPTN)患者脑灰质形态改变。方法利用VBM-DARTEL算法,对30例CPTN患者(CPTN组)及30名年龄、性别相匹配的健康志愿者(正常对照组)的3D-T1W序列脑结构数据行VBM处理及统计分析,探讨CPTN患者脑灰质体积改变及其与临床指标(病程及量表评分)的相关性。结果与正常对照相比,CPTN患者双侧前扣带回(ACC)后部及中扣带回(MCC)、双侧颞叶、双侧丘脑、左侧海马及海马旁回、右侧中央前回灰质体积减小,右侧后扣带回(PCC)及右侧顶叶灰质体积增大(P均<0.05),但所有差异脑区的灰质体积与临床指标之间无线性相关关系。结论 CPTN患者存在多个脑区灰质体积的异常,VBM方法能显示这些改变,为临床评价CPTN患者脑形态学异常提供客观的影像学依据。

【Abstract】 Objective To assess the morphological changes of cerebral gray matter(GM)in patients with chronic primary trigeminal neuralgia(CPTN)using voxel-based morphometry(VBM).Methods Anatomical data of 30 patients with CPTN and 30age-and sex-matched healthy volunteers were included and analyzed with VBM DARTEL algorithm.Then statistical analysis was performed to compare the morphological changes of GM and the correlation between GM volume(GMV)and clinical indexes containing disease duration and pain scores of CPTN.Results Compared with healthy controls,decreased GMV was found in bilateral posterior portion of anterior cingulated cortex(ACC),bilateral middle cingulated cortex(MCC),bilateral temporal lobe,bilateral thalamus,left hippocampal gyrus and parahippocampal gyrus,right precentral gyrus,as well as increased GMV in right posterior cingulated cortex(PCC)and right parietal lobe in CPTN patients(all,P<0.05).Moreover,no linear correlations were found between the above-mentioned GMV changes and clinical indexes.Conclusion CPTN patients have multiple cerebral regions of GMV abnormality,and VBM method can reveal these changes,which may provide objective image information to evaluate the cerebral morphological abnormalities of CPTN.
